[X86] Remove little support we had for MPX

GCC 9.1 removed Intel MPX support. Linux kernel removed MPX in 2019.
glibc 2.35 will remove MPX.

Our support is limited: we support assembling of bndmov but not bnd.
Just remove it.

[X86-64] Support Intel AMX instructions

Summary:
INTEL ADVANCED MATRIX EXTENSIONS (AMX).
AMX is a new programming paradigm, it has a set of 2-dimensional registers
(TILES) representing sub-arrays from a larger 2-dimensional memory image and
operate on TILES.

[X86][Disassembler] Replace custom logger with LLVM_DEBUG

llvm-objdump -d on clang is decreased from 7.8s to 7.4s.

The improvement is likely due to the elimination of logger setup and
dbgprintf(), which has a large overhead.

[X86][Disassembler] Fix LOCK prefix disassembler support

Summary:
If LOCK prefix is not the first prefix in an instruction, LLVM
disassembler silently drops the prefix.

The fix is to select a proper instruction with a builtin LOCK prefix if
one exists.

[X86] Fix disassembling of EVEX instructions to stop accidentally decoding the SIB index register as an XMM/YMM/ZMM register.

This introduces a new operand type to encode the whether the index register should be XMM/YMM/ZMM. And new code to fixup the results created by readSIB.

This has the nice effect of removing a bunch of code that hard coded the name of every GATHER and SCATTER instruction to map the index type.

This fixes PR32807.
